Baldwin-Wallace College Running Back Brandon Hedges and Men's Soccer

Goalie Nate Christian are OAC Players of the Week

BEREA, OHIO -- Baldwin-Wallace College sophomore football running back Brandon Hedges (Oregon/ Clay High School) and junior Academic All-Ohio Athletic Conference men's soccer goalie Nate Christian (North Ridgeville H.S.) have been selected this week as OAC players-of-the-week in their respective sports.

Hedges earned his honor as he ran for 156 yards and three touchdowns in his first collegiate start in a 27-14 win at Allegheny (Pa.) College on Saturday, September 4. Hedges scored on runs of 38, 16 and 28 yards and also caught three passes for 31 yards. B-W will be back in action this Saturday, September 18 when it opens OAC play and hosts rival Ohio Northern University at 6:30 p.m. at The George Finnie Stadium on Community Day in Berea.

Christian, an Academic All-OAC and CoSIDA Academic All-District IV selection last fall, earned OAC Player of the Week honors for the second time in his career. He earned the award this time for leading B-W to three wins last week, including a pair of 2-1 wins and a tournament title at the prestigious Virginia Wesleyan University Invitational in Norfolk, Virginia. In his two games at the VWU tourney, Christian allowed just two goals and made nine saves as the Yellow Jackets defeated a pair of teams that were preseason nationally-ranked. For the season, Christian is allowing 1.17 goals per game and has 21 saves for the 5-1 overall Yellow Jackets who next play on Wednesday, Sept. 15 against LaRoche College in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ania.
